WebSep 14, 2024 · Prevention should always be the primary goal: Maintain strong abdominal and back core muscles to help stabilize your spine and prevent strain on back muscles. Live a healthy lifestyle, including weight management and low-impact aerobic exercises, to build muscle strength and prevent strain. Maintain a neutral posture when sitting or standing.

WebOveruse such as repeated throwing or leaning over in a stressful position for prolonged periods may cause the muscles of the lower back to pull away or tear. The Mayo Clinic reports that actions involving excessive force or undue repetition often cause fatigue and an aching type of back pain.
